Stay near popular Harrogate attractions

A modern building with a curved facade, large glass windows, and red brick accents.

Harrogate Convention Centre

8.8/10 (151 reviews)
This premier North Yorkshire venue hosts diverse events in its impressive 2,000-seat auditorium and multiple halls. Enjoy conferences, exhibitions, or shows with easy access to Harrogate's charming shops and restaurants.

A castle by a calm lake surrounded by lush greenery and a clear sky.

Ripley Castle and Gardens

8.8/10 (44 reviews)
This 700-year-old ancestral home of the Ingilby family showcases elegant architecture and centuries of English history. Explore the stained-glass interiors and gardens where deer and geese roam freely.

A large rock formation with a balanced rock stack in a forested area.

Brimham Rocks

9.6/10 (26 reviews)
These 320-million-year-old rock formations, shaped like dancing bears and sphinxes, create a natural labyrinth across the moorland. Climb to panoramic viewpoints or discover their geological stories.

Royal Hall

9.0/10 (20 reviews)
This magnificent Edwardian theatre dazzles with gilded balconies and intricate plasterwork dating from 1903. Arrive early to admire the architectural details before enjoying a performance in Harrogate's cultural jewel.

Turkish Baths and Health Spa

9.2/10 (118 reviews)
Step into one of Britain's few fully restored Victorian Turkish baths with stunning Moorish architecture. Experience the traditional thermal journey through heated chambers and invigorating plunges in the cold pool.

Learn more about Harrogate

Elegant Victorian spa town Harrogate invites you to sample mineral waters at the Royal Pump Room Museum and wander through Valley Gardens' colourful flowerbeds. Take afternoon tea at the famous Bettys Tea Rooms, then explore the surrounding Yorkshire Dales' hiking trails and historic villages.

Where to stay in and around Harrogate

Harrogate offers a delightful blend of adventure and relaxation, making it an ideal destination for tourists. Explore the elegant spa town, renowned for its beautiful gardens and friendly atmosphere. Just a short distance away, discover the picturesque countryside and charming villages, perfect for family-friendly outings. Don't miss the vibrant centre of Harrogate, where you can indulge in local shops and cafes, all while soaking in the essence of this Yorkshire gem.

  • Knaresborough: Nestled a mere 5km from Harrogate, Knaresborough is a charming market town renowned for its stunning scenery and outdoor adventures. Visitors are often drawn to its picturesque landscapes, historic architecture, and the iconic Knaresborough Castle, which overlooks the River Nidd. The town's recreational areas are perfect for walking and enjoying nature, while the nearby national parks invite exploration. Knaresborough also boasts a vibrant golfing scene with well-maintained courses. Peak visitor numbers occur in April and from July to August, making it a lively destination during these months.
  • Harrogate City Centre: The heart of Harrogate, the City Centre is a delightful neighbourhood filled with elegance and charm. Known for its stunning gardens and historic buildings, such as the Royal Pump Room Museum, it offers a fantastic base for exploring the area. The City Centre is also home to numerous shops, restaurants, and a thriving café culture, perfect for a leisurely afternoon. Outdoor enthusiasts will appreciate the proximity to national parks and recreational areas, while major events often take place, attracting visitors particularly in July to August and October.
  • Greenhow Hill: Located within the Harrogate district, Greenhow Hill is a quaint village set amidst breathtaking countryside. It’s an ideal spot for those seeking tranquillity and outdoor pursuits, such as walking and hiking in the stunning natural surroundings. Visitors can enjoy the local spa facilities for relaxation after a day of exploration. The village sees a surge in visitors from July to September, offering a perfect escape into nature, with national parks nearby that showcase the beauty of the Yorkshire Dales.

Best time to go to Harrogate

The best time to visit Harrogate can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Harrogate falls in July, when vis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Harrogate falls in January,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

What's the seasonal weather like in Harrogate?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 14°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 4°C. Average annual precipitation for Harrogate is 785 mm.
